Jeff Olson


Birthday
01/29/2026
thingson.tv Credits
1

Filmography

Star Wars: Episode I - The Phantom Menace poster
Star Wars: Episode I - The Phantom Menace

Pod Race Spectator in Jabba's Private Box (uncredited)